Title: Ed Harrold: Innovator in Networked Access Control Systems

Introduction

Ed Harrold is a notable inventor based in Brooksville, FL (US). He has made significant contributions to the field of networked access control systems. With a total of 4 patents to his name, Harrold's work focuses on enhancing security and user verification through innovative technology.

Latest Patents

One of Ed Harrold's latest patents is a networked access control system. This invention includes methods and systems for controlling a network access control system that features a server encrypting a first identifier related to a registered user. The server communicates the encrypted first identifier to a mobile device. The lock device then receives a first data set from the mobile device, which includes the encrypted first identifier. The lock device may encrypt this first data set to generate a second data set and communicates the encrypted second data set back to the mobile device. The server subsequently receives a third data set that includes the encrypted second data set and a second identifier related to the registered user. The server extracts the first and second identifiers from the communicated third data set and compares them to verify their relationship.

Career Highlights

Ed Harrold is currently employed at Schlage Lock Company LLC, where he continues to develop innovative security solutions. His work has been instrumental in advancing the technology used in access control systems.

Collaborations

Throughout his career, Ed has collaborated with notable colleagues, including Jeffrey Scott Neafsey and Joseph W. Baumgarte. These partnerships have contributed to the successful development of his patented technologies.
